WebApr 10, 2024 · noun. : increased negativity of the membrane potential of a neuron on the postsynaptic side of a nerve synapse that is caused by a neurotransmitter (as gamma-aminobutyric acid) which renders the membrane selectively permeable to potassium and chloride ions on the inside but not to sodium ions on the outside and that tends to inhibit … WebSince the equilibrium potential of K + ions is more negative than the resting membrane potential, the opening of K + channels gives rise to an outward current (an exit of positive charges) and to a hyperpolarization of the membrane; i.e. an IPSP. If this IPSP is concomitant with an EPSP, it will reduce the amplitude of the EPSP.

WebEPSP is due to influx of sodium ion. If IPSP is produced, postsynaptic region becomes hyperpolarized and hence there will not be development of action potential in postsynaptic region. IPSP will be due to efflux of potassium ions or influx of chloride ions at postsynaptic regions. Properties of Synapse: 1.
